Overview

This topic is designed to enable students to identify and investigate issues arising from theoretical and research literature in the field of disability. Students will independently research an area of interest, provide critical analysis and articulate a research and practice nexus.

Aims

This topic aims to equip students with the resources to comprehensively analyse an area of interest in a disability-related area. Students will undertake a critical review of literature and present the findings.

Learning outcomes

On completion of this topic you will be expected to be able to:
1.
Formulate a plan for conducting a literature review on a disability related issue, and reporting on the findings
2.
Critically review appraise and sythesise literature in area of disability
3.
Communicate the literature and research findings, including in accessible ways
